    Here's a case of something that I thought I mis-remembered but it eventually turned out that I was actually right all along. Back when I was a child, I couldn't get past Carnival Night (or Marble Garden if playing as Tails alone...) in S3K. One day at a party I watched someone else play through the game and get really far into it. I think they made to Lava Reef or Sandopolis. What I distinctly remember seeing when they got the seventh Chaos Emerald was the message "Sonic can now go to Hidden Palace". It would be years and years before I ever saw that message again, and I was convinced that I'd imagined it. Someone else on here brought it up some time ago and it turns out that this message is only displayed if you get the seventh Chaos Emerald after visiting Hidden Palace at the start of Mushroom Hill. It makes sense that I'd never seen it because whenever I got the Chaos Emeralds before I'd always managed it below reaching Mushroom Hill.
